How much do internship remote business administration j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for internship remote business administration in Silver Spring, MD is $17.91,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.67 and $19.62 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Internship Remote Business Administration vs Remote Office Assistant?

AspectInternship Remote Business AdministrationRemote Office Assistant
Required CredentialsTypically students or recent graduates; some familiarity with business conceptsHigh school diploma or equivalent; basic administrative skills
Work EnvironmentRemote, often flexible hours, focused on learning and support tasksRemote or hybrid, handling administrative tasks like scheduling and correspondence
Employer & Industry UsageBusinesses, startups, educational institutions seeking interns for business supportCompanies, small businesses, organizations needing administrative assistance
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ding internship roles in business administrationFinding remote administrative support roles

Internship Remote Business Administration focuses on providing students or recent graduates with practical experience in business operations, often involving learning and support tasks. Remote Office Assistant roles are more operational, assisting with administrative duties like scheduling and correspondence. Both roles are remote but differ in experience level and responsibilities.

Job Title: Business Intel Analyst Location: Vienna, VA Work Model: Hybrid – onsite and remote

Responsibilities

  • li>Support Quality Control Risk Management by delivering accurate, timely, and actionable reporting and analytics for QCRM leaders, Real Estate Lending business partners, and audit or exam stakeholders.
  • Maintain recurring reports and dashboards, validate reporting outputs, analyze trends and risks, support system administration activities, and translate business needs into clear reporting requirements.
  • Create, refresh, validate, and distribute various recurring reports and dashboards including monthly QC reporting and management-level reports.
  • Analyze QC results, trends, defects, exceptions, operational patterns, and emerging risks to inform leadership and support decision-making.
  • Apply data validation, cleaning, reconciliation, and quality control techniques to ensure reporting accuracy and reliability.
  • Maintain documentation, validation, approval, and evidence records in coordination with designated reviewers.
  • Utilize business intelligence tools such as Power BI, SQL, Excel, and Power Query to build, troubleshoot, and improve reports.
  • Facilitate stakeholder discussions to gather requirements, define audiences, confirm data sources, and align deliverables with business needs.
  • Support reporting request management through tools such as ADO, SharePoint, and others.
  • Assist with system administration, access governance, and security activities related to reporting tools.
  • Develop and maintain procedures, technical documentation, and audit-ready support materials.
  • Support audit, regulatory, and management requests by documenting data sources, calculations, and conclusions clearly and defensibly.
  • Identify reporting gaps, data quality issues, and process inefficiencies, and recommend improvements.
  • Participate in modernization initiatives including automation and dashboard migration.
  • Communicate findings, risks, and report updates effectively to technical and non-technical stakeholders.

Requirements

  • 2 to 5 years of experience in data analysis, reporting, or business intelligence
  • Understanding of business operations, risk management, and reporting lifecycles
  • Proficient with Power BI, SQL, Excel, Power Query, and data visualization tools
  • Knowledge of data validation, reconciliation, and quality practices
  • Strong analytical and troubleshooting skills with attention to detail
  • Effective communication and stakeholder management skills
  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Statistics, Data Analytics, or related field
  • Experience supporting regulatory or audit reporting is a plus
